Description marder 2012-06-09 21:35:12 UTC
As professional photographer I use two monitors. 
But its not possible for me to drag the preview-window in fullscrenn on a second monitor (so that I have the lighttable & metadta on the other

The preview is too small on one monitor (its not a fullscrenn like in geeqie, gthumb, gwenview ecc), so a second-monitor-preview could help.
